Публикации по теме 'coding-style'


Как писать CSS, когда вы ненавидите CSS
Перейти от Cee-Ess-Ess к Cee-Ess-YES! Я ненавижу CSS. Что ж, я ненавидел CSS. Во время обучения написанию кода CSS казался неработоспособным черным ящиком. Двойная задача - решить, как что-то должно выглядеть, а затем заставить это выглядеть таким образом, казалась просто невозможной. Что, естественно, привело к глубоко укоренившейся ненависти ко всему искусству. Однако оказывается, что во многом это отвращение вызвано отсутствием процесса структурирования и написания хороших..

Как я начал свою жизнь кодирования без каких-либо предварительных знаний о программировании?
После провала в JEE-2019 я поступил в Технологический университет Мадан Мохан Малавия, Горакхпур, Уттар-Прадеш. Когда я поступил в колледж, моей первоочередной задачей было наслаждаться жизнью и заставлять Фрейндда делать что угодно. Я помню, что это был мой первый день в классе (в августе 2019 года), Учитель задавал вопросы по программированию и другим вещам. Некоторые из моих очень талантливых товарищей по команде отвечали на это, а я даже не понимал вопросов. В тот день я решил..

Шаг 4. Автоматизируйте свой стандарт кодирования ~ Филип ван Лаенен
Это четвертый шаг к прохождению серии Programming Enlightenment . Если вы не усвоили третий шаг , прочтите его. «Любой дурак может написать код, понятный компьютеру. Хорошие программисты пишут код, понятный людям» ~ Мартин Фаулер Грамотно написанный код — это произведение искусства. Он так же элегантен, как шедевр Ван Гог . Этот элегантно написанный код соответствует стандарту, более известному как стандарт/условия кодирования . Что такое стандарт..

Что должен делать начинающий программист?
Начинающий программист должен делать следующие вещи, чтобы ... Выберите свой язык , не выбирайте какой-либо язык, потому что он популярен, выберите некоторые базовые, такие как C, который охватывает все концепции программирования, Чтобы позже вы могли легко переключиться на любой язык по вашему выбору. Помимо языка C (который раньше был популярен среди новичков), вы также можете выбрать Python . После того, как вы выбрали свой язык, теперь начинайте кодировать на нем базовые..

Сокращение кода - Часть 2
В первой части серии мы обсудили преимущества сокращения вашего кода. Мы также узнали, что чрезмерная обрезка может плохо сказаться на вашем программном обеспечении. Во второй части мы рассмотрим несколько примеров условных выражений и способы их решения с помощью ООП-дизайна и некоторых с помощью JavaScript. Что касается ООП, мы также увидим, как наши решения могут приблизить нас к принципам S.O.L.I.D . Принцип единой ответственности Принцип открытия / закрытия Лисков Принцип..

Структура и интерпретация компьютерных программ Резюме главы 1.1
Долго размышляя о взаимосвязи информатики и естественных наук, я решил прочитать интересную книгу на тему того, как формируются языки программирования для решения задач и что требуется от компьютерных программ, чтобы они могли эффективно создавать надежные вычислительные системы. Первая глава начинается со ссылки на атомарные элементы языка программирования и соотносит их с концепциями формирования идей. Отличная цитата с первой страницы гласит: Действия ума, в которых он проявляет..

Уроки из книги Стива МакКоннелла «Код завершен»: выбор типа цикла
Одна из самых сложных задач начинающих программистов - это возможность выбрать, какой тип цикла использовать, когда требуется структура повторения. В своей книге Code Complete Стив МакКоннелл дает некоторые рекомендации по выбору циклов. В этой статье я рассмотрю эти рекомендации на примерах из языков, которые он не использовал в своей книге - JavaScript (с использованием оболочки Spidermonkey) и Python. В большинстве языков есть три основных типа циклов. Это цикл for , цикл..